Mr.Akshay Lal Pandit 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E ANIL KUMAR UPADHYAY ORAL ORDER 04-02-2020 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and the State as well as informant.
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and State. The petitioner is in custody in connection with Sherghati P.S. Case No. 152 of 2016 for the offence under Sections 323, 504 and 498(A)/34 of the Indian Penal Code.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that the petitioner has got no criminal antecedent and he is in custody since 25.04.2019. He further submits that the petitioner is ready to part with 40% of his salary towards the maintenance of the 1st wife and the offspring.
Learned counsel for the informant has no objection, if
Patna High Court CR. MISC. No.5888 of 2020(2) dt.04-02-2020 2/2 the petitioner undertakes to part with 40% of his salary towards the maintenance of informant (opposite party no.2) and the offspring.
Considering the aforesaid, the petitioner, named above, is directed to be released on bail on furnishing bail bonds of Rs.50,000/- (Rupees fifty th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of Additional Chief Judicial Magistrate, Sherghati, Gaya in connection with Sherghati P.S. Case No. 152 of 2016.
The Court below shall ensure filing of undertaking to that effect before releasing the petitioner. (Anil Kumar Upadhyay, J) uday/- U T
